PART A - MAIN ITEMS
Collection of dry, wet and hazardous waste separately daily from individual flats/ public buildings on different floors of the buildings with or without lifts , loading it in waste transport vehicle all inclusive of the cost of basket and bags, cost of labour etc, complete all as directed by the Engineer-in-Charge. Garbage is to be collected from all the flats/public buildings in morning hours.
From residential buildings details of which are given in Annex. "A" (Total 4340 flats X 361days)
From Public buildings details of which are given in Annex. "B" (34 locations/buildings x 361 days)
Sweeping & cleaning the passages, corridors, circulation area, stilted areas, approach roads including footpath way etc. daily and surroundings of buildings( area around the buildings from edge of the building upto storm water drain of the buildings) including cost of labours, baskets, brooms and tools required for carrying out the work etc. complete all as directed by the Engineer-in-Charge. Frequency of cleaning shall be once in a day.
Of Residential bldgs: Details of buildings are given in Annex. "A" (145*361 days)
B) Non Residential buildings: TTM1 Maint. unit, TTM2 Maint. unit, TTM2 Staff room, Dilwara PH office, Dilwara Project office, Krishna site office, Public Health office, Aravali substation, Western Sector Maint. unit, Western Sector Maint. office no 2, Main Pump House, Security Gate No 4, Hospital Security Gate, Western sector market, Sector market, Brindavan market. (10X313days)(6nosx361days)
Mopping only the passages, corridors, staircases, landings etc. with phenyled water including cost of labour, phenyle and other cleaning materials such as tools, moppers with wooden handles, mopping dusters etc. complete all as directed by the Engineer-in-charge (frequency: fortnightly)
Of Residential bldgs: Details of buildings are given in Annex. "A" (145*12*2 moppings)
B) Non Residential buildings:TTM1 Maint. unit, TTM2 Maint. unit, TTM2 Staff room, Dilwara PH office, Dilwara Project office, Krishna site office, Public Health office, Aravali substation, Western Sector Maint. unit, Western Sector Maint. office no 2, Main Pump House, Security Gate No 4, Hospital Security Gate (10X313days) (3nosx361days)
Removing cob-webs from the staircases, stilted areas, common area, circulation areas, canopies, etc. of Residential buildings and of cabins/ rooms/ and other areas also of public buildingds once in a month including cost of labour, tools such as ladders, brooms with stick etc.complete all as directed by the Engineer-in-chargeResidential buildings: from (frequency: Once in a month)
Of Residential bldgs: Details of buildings are given in Annex. "A" (145*12*1 cleaning)
B) Non Residential buildings:TTM1 Maint. unit, TTM2 Maint. unit, TTM2 Staff room, Dilwara PH office, Dilwara Project office, Krishna site office, Public Health office, Aravali substation, Main Pump House, Security Gate No 4, Hospital Security Gate, Western Sector Maint. unit, Western Sector Maint. office no 2, Western sector market, Sector market, Brindavan market. (16 nos x 12 months)
Toilet blocks cleaning & mopping the entire toilet blocks with phenyled water, harpic including cleaning the glass windows, wash basins, etc, removal of cobwebs, general cleaning of surrounding areas, placing liquid soap with dispenser, keeping air purifier inside the toilet blocks once in a week, removing stains from the wall, urinal pans, WC & flooring, etc all including cost of labours, phenyle, harpic and other materials required for cleaning, mopping and washing purpose, etc. complete all as directed by the Engineer-In-Charge, (Frequency: thrice in a day) (12x313 days) + (10x361days)
Mechanical transportation of wet and dry garbage, garden waste collected during sweeping & cleaning around the building by pick up van (02 nos) from all the residential & public buildings as given in Annexure A & B in containers with lids over them for tranportation of the waste to concerned Waste Processing Centre (WPC) for further disposal at composting facilities behind Rajanigandha, Tapti and Brindavan Bio gas plants near Training School Hostel and near BARC Hospital canteen, transporting back left over dry garbage after segregation from Organic waste composting machine/Bio gas plant to garbage bin, Tranporting the manure to various locations, including loading, unloading including cost of vehicle (Mahindra Bolero Pickup van or equivalent), driver, fuel, labour (04 nos) for loading & unloading, etc all complete as directed by Engineer-In-Charge (02 nos vehicle * 361 days) There are 145 residential and 32 public buildings which consist of about 3988 flats and market places. The daily present collection of wet waste is about approx 6 ton/day and manure generated is about approx. 600 kg/ day.
Sweeping, cleaning, collecting and disposing the garbage, benches, removing the stains, washing place, transporting the waste generated manually, etc by deploying 01 labour separately at the following locations 1) Sangam Jalvayu vihar 2) Chidambaram park all including labour, tools and materials required for cleaning all complete as per directions of EIC. (Frequency: (freq 02 times*361days)
Providing & spreading bleaching powder of Grade II quality or equivalent on the approach road, pathways, passages of the buildings & its surrounding areas wherever the area is found slippery or as and when required, including cost of labour transportation, loading & unloading all complete as directed by Engineer-In-Charge
